“…The observations suggested that the movement of a mite from the cell opening to the bottom took about 1 min. When studying the recordings of the position of the bees at the cell opening over 3 min before the mite reached the cell bottom, Boot et al [10] concluded that it was not necessary for the bee to place its head and thorax into the brood cell for mite invasion. Apparently, mites left bees when brought in close proximity to a brood cell.…”

“…This may be understood as follows. A mite has to be carried close to a brood cell by a bee before invasion occurs (Boot et al, 1994b), and only some of the honey bees in a colony reside near a cell suitable for mite invasion. Therefore, the number of bees that bring a mite close enough to a brood cell may determine how many mites invade, and this number of bees will increase when there are more brood cells present per bee, ie a higher brood/bees ratio (Boot et al, 1994a).…”
